Tanker Talks 2.0 brings resiliency-focused conversations to McConnell

Members of Team McConnell navigate a non-motorized vehicle through a course while wearing impairment simulation goggles during Tanker Talks 2.0 at McConnell Air Force Base, Feb. 9, 2026. The activity was designed to demonstrate how alcohol and THC-related impairment can affect coordination, reaction time and decision-making in a controlled environment.
